Dioscorea elephantipes, also known as the Elephant Foot plant, is a slow-growing species that attains a height of 10 feet and a width of 3 feet. As it matures, it develops a thick caudex that resembles an elephant's foot or a miniature tree trunk, with a rough and textured surface. As a summer-deciduous plant, its leaves fall off during the summer, and its stems typically die back, only to be replaced by new shoots in winter. In late fall and early winter, the greenish-yellow flowers appear, adding a touch of charm to this already intriguing plant. The flowers are dioecious, with male and female flowers produced on separate plants. The male flowers grow in erect racemes, while the female flowers grow in spinescent spikes. They emerge on long, slender stalks from the Dioscorea elephantipes caudex, making this plant even more enchanting.

The Dioscorea elephantipes is known to have mild toxicity for humans and pets if ingested, due to the presence of saponins. These substances can cause gastrointestinal discomfort, nausea, and vomiting. To prevent any potential harm, it is recommended to keep this succulent out of reach from curious children and pets.
